Jeremy Alger Email

Customer Success Manager . iPayables

Current Roles

Employees:
56
Revenue:
$7.3M
About
iPayables Address
180 N University Ave
Aliso Viejo, CA
United States
iPayables Email

Past Companies

iPayables, a DocuPhase solutionCustomer Success Manager
iPayablesProject Manager
Max International LLCBusiness Process Analysts

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.